当前位置: 首页 > news >正文

【Day3:JAVA运算符、方法的介绍】

目录

  • 1、运算符
    • 1.1 赋值运算符
    • 1.2 比较运算符
    • 1.3 逻辑运算符
      • 1.3.1 逻辑运算符概述
      • 1.3.2 逻辑运算符分类
      • 1.3.3 短路的逻辑运算符
    • 1.4 三元运算符
    • 1.5 运算符优先级
  • 2、方法
    • 2.1 方法介绍
    • 2.2 方法的定义和调用格式
      • 2.2.1 方法的调用
      • 2.2.2 带参数方法的调用
      • 2.2.3 带返回值方法的调用
      • 2.2.4 方法通用的调用
    • 2.3 方法的常见问题
    • 2.4 方法的重载

1、运算符

第二天介绍了算数运算符自增自减运算符,今天继续运算符的介绍。

1.1 赋值运算符

在这里插入图片描述

1.2 比较运算符

在这里插入图片描述

1.3 逻辑运算符

1.3.1 逻辑运算符概述

在这里插入图片描述

1.3.2 逻辑运算符分类

在这里插入图片描述

1.3.3 短路的逻辑运算符

在这里插入图片描述

简单来说,左边如果已经能判断整体的结果,则不会再执行右边,所以效率高,建议使用带有短路的的逻辑运算符。

1.4 三元运算符

在这里插入图片描述

1.5 运算符优先级

在这里插入图片描述

2、方法

2.1 方法介绍

在这里插入图片描述

2.2 方法的定义和调用格式

2.2.1 方法的调用

在这里插入图片描述
在这里插入图片描述

案例:
在这里插入图片描述

2.2.2 带参数方法的调用

在这里插入图片描述
在这里插入图片描述
在这里插入图片描述

2.2.3 带返回值方法的调用

在这里插入图片描述
在这里插入图片描述
调用:
在这里插入图片描述

2.2.4 方法通用的调用

在这里插入图片描述

2.3 方法的常见问题

在这里插入图片描述

2.4 方法的重载

在这里插入图片描述

案例:
在这里插入图片描述
在这里插入图片描述

http://www.lryc.cn/news/350199.html

相关文章:

  • Chrome查看User Agent的实战教程
  • Linux 第三十四章
  • 国际化日期(inti)
  • 【论文阅读笔记】jTrans(ISSTA 22)
  • 单位个人如何向期刊投稿发表文章?
  • Redis数据结构-RedisObject
  • Vue 中使用 el-date-picker 限制只能选择当天、当天之前或当天之后日期的方法详解
  • 系列介绍:《创意代码:Processing艺术编程之旅》
  • 深度学习设计模式之抽象工厂模式
  • K8s是什么?
  • 【网站项目】SpringBoot796水产养殖系统
  • Vue详细介绍
  • 声纹识别的对抗与防御
  • C++ QT设计模式总结
  • 洛谷 P3203:弹飞绵羊 ← 分块算法(单点更新、单点查询)
  • 程序验证之Dafny--证明霍尔逻辑的半自动化利器
  • Flutter 中的 SafeArea 小部件:全面指南
  • webpack生成模块关系依赖图示例:查看构建产物的组成部分 依赖关系图
  • Spacy的安装与使用教程
  • Pathlib,一个不怕迷路的 Python 向导
  • 详解绝对路径和相对路径的区别
  • C++二叉搜索树搜索二叉树二叉排序树
  • Java 自然排序和比较器排序区别?Comparable接口和Comparator比较器区别?
  • 【CV】opencv调用DIS/LK等计算光流,前一帧和当前帧写反了有什么影响?
  • C语言学习细节|C语言面向对象编程!函数指针如何正确使用
  • C语言简要(一)
  • 那些年我与c++的叫板(一)--string类自实现
  • 二刷算法训练营Day08 | 字符串(1/2)
  • 使用高防IP是应对网络安全的重要措施
  • 代码随想录-算法训练营day40【动态规划03:整数拆分、不同的二叉搜索树】